Transaction 506262eae3fcfe79833e0707bb2a1223507f8c5e4d3048a83fdafb91ec6dcfed

4 Input
2 Outputs
  • 506262eae3fcfe79833e0707bb2a1223507f8c5e4d3048a83fdafb91ec6dcfed:0
  • value  4245508
    address  1KdShgmfWZ4vE7Djaq6KS96k5U5MdaXdhY
  • 506262eae3fcfe79833e0707bb2a1223507f8c5e4d3048a83fdafb91ec6dcfed:1
  • value  1000259
    address  36XKfTkuJtL71FJFPMzErB9GuGCAJ7XyY9